The Initial Comments That Sparked Outrage

Dr. Heavenly’s latest controversy stems from a video where she appeared to make disparaging remarks about gay men, suggesting that they were not “real men.”
In her discussion, she implied that only heterosexual men could truly embody masculinity.
“When you have a conversation with somebody and somebody gets upset and it goes to the left, most men, real men—not gay men, not men who are kind of soft—but real men are going to feel like, if you tell my wife to shut up, I’m going to have a problem with it,” Dr. Heavenly said in her video.
Her choice of words immediately ignited outrage, particularly within the LGBTQ+ community and among her wider audience.
Many saw the comments as demeaning and reinforcing harmful stereotypes.

The Deleted Video & Attempts at Damage Control
Perhaps realizing the severity of the backlash, Dr. Heavenly quickly deleted the video from her YouTube channel.
![]()
However, as with all things on the internet, the damage had already been done. Screenshots and screen recordings of the video continued to circulate, and blogs were quick to pick up on the scandal.
This deletion only fueled further speculation. Did she remove it because she recognized her mistake, or was it simply a move to avoid the growing fallout?
Many believe it was the latter, as Dr. Heavenly has yet to issue a formal statement apologizing for her remarks.

The Funky Dineva Perspective: A Friend’s Take

One of Dr. Heavenly’s closest associates, Funky Dineva, weighed in on the controversy. As a well-known media personality and a member of the LGBTQ+ community himself, many looked to him for his reaction.
Funky Dineva shared that Dr. Heavenly has made similar comments in private before, even in his presence.
While he expressed disappointment in her words, he also made it clear that he was not surprised.
“What Dr. Heavenly said is how a lot of people feel,” Funky Dineva stated. “I’ve learned to navigate this world being considered ‘less than a man’ since I was in the third grade. I can either let it upset me or move on.”
His response was a mix of resignation and understanding. While he condemned the comments, he acknowledged that such beliefs are still prevalent in many communities.
